Abu al-Hassan Ali ibn Muhammad ibn Muhammad[2], better known as Ali 'izz al-Din Ibn al- Athir al-Jazari[3] (1160 – 1233) was an Arab muslim historian born in Cizre, a town in present-day Şırnak province in south-eastern Turkey, from the Ibn Athir family. According to the 1911 Edition of Encyclopaedia Britannica, he was born in Jazirat Ibn Umar in Kurdistan [1]. According to the Encyclopaedia of Islam, he was Kurdish [4].
Biography
He spent a scholarly life in Mosul, but often visited Baghdad. For a time he was with Saladin's army in Syria and later lived in Aleppo and Damascus. His chief work was a history of the world, al-Kamil fi at-tarikh (The Complete History). He includes some information on the Rus' people in his chronology.Works
- The Complete History - (Arabic Al-Kamil fi al-Tarikh).
- The Lions of the Forest and the knowledge about the Companions - (Arabic Usud al-Ghabah fi Ma'rifah al-Sahabah).
